A 15-year-old class 9 student at Roots Country School in Baghi, Shimla district, died on Sunday morning after falling from the fifth floor of the hostel building. Jessica Sharma, from Panipat district in Haryana, was rushed to Government Hospital Kotkhai where she was declared brought dead.

The incident occurred around 6 AM when most students were asleep due to the Sunday holiday. The school management immediately informed the family members about the tragedy. Police officials have confirmed the incident and registered a case, with investigations currently ongoing.

Her uncle Amit Sharma stated that Jessica had come home a few days ago due to illness. On Saturday evening, she called her mother saying, “Tell papa that I don’t want to take admission here next session.” He added that Jessica was performing well academically, making the incident difficult to understand.

Family members reviewed CCTV footage at the school and hostel with police, which showed the student going to the fifth floor in the morning. However, the exact location from where she fell could not be determined from the footage. Jessica’s elder brother is also a class 12 student at the same school.

The student was brought to Kotkhai Health Centre after the incident, where doctors declared her dead. The post-mortem examination will be conducted at IGMC Shimla on Monday. Local police have confirmed the case but have not shared official information about the circumstances. Shimla Superintendent of Police Sanjeev Gandhi stated that police are investigating all aspects of the case.

Family members said Jessica never mentioned any problems either at home or at school, making the circumstances surrounding this tragic incident unclear. The investigation continues as authorities work to understand what led to this tragedy.
